Castle View Apartments

1720 Bellevue Rd, Atwater, CA 95301, United States

Atwater, CA 95301

(209) 358-7994

Photos

More Apartments Near Castle View Apartments

Falcon Heights Apartments

(209) 357 - 3880

2069 Bellevue Rd, Atwater, CA 95301, United States

Redwood Apartments

(209) 485 - 8387

2350 Redwood Ave, Atwater, CA 95301, United States